Title: Modeling Autism in the Mouse (Research Advisor: Dr. Jessica Nadler, Biology Sponsor: Dr. Jason Lieb)
Ryan P. Barbaro In order to further the understanding of autism, we are researching the link between autistic-like behavior in mice and their genes. We analyze mouse behavior with three tests to see how closely the mouse's behavior resembles autistic behavior. Then we compare all the genes from all the mice to see which genes are differentially active in mice that behave autistically. The differentially active genes will be some of the genes that make it more likely for a mouse to develop autistic-like behavior. Hopefully, analogous genes in humans will be related to the occurrence of autism in people |
